Output 34d5c8e46b92c06ff86458e681040444734c0c1c24590f0f744fe93b91e8c7d0:22

value
25088480
script pubkey
OP_0 OP_PUSHBYTES_20 c93644a19c1623b7679de23c583b0552b64cc895
address
ltc1qeymyfgvuzc3mweuaug79swc922myejy4kxje0l
transaction
34d5c8e46b92c06ff86458e681040444734c0c1c24590f0f744fe93b91e8c7d0
spent
true